When two record owners convey Kansas real estate in one instrument, the deed has to carry the whole record: two grantor blocks, two marital status lines, two signatures with printed names beneath them, and an acknowledgment certificate for each signer. This Kansas Warranty Deed (Two Grantors) is arranged for exactly that record, conveying the entire interest of both owners with the statutory covenants of K.S.A. 58-2203.

Two owners, one set of covenants

Kansas attaches its warranty covenants to the operative words of the statutory form, and this deed carries them in the plural: the grantors CONVEY AND WARRANT to the grantee, and the instrument states the covenants that follow from K.S.A. 58-2203, seisin, the right to convey, quiet possession, freedom from encumbrances, and a promise to defend the title against lawful claims. An exceptions section holds the recorded easements, restrictions, and current taxes that the parties intend to carve out of the encumbrance covenant, and under K.S.A. 58-2202 the deed passes the entire estate of both grantors unless its express terms show a lesser one. Because Kansas has no separate statutory form for co-owner conveyances, the same two operative words do the work whether the grantors hold as joint tenants or as tenants in common; both interests merge into the single conveyance the grantee takes.

Married grantors and the homestead consent rule

The two-grantor record appears most often as a married couple conveying a home they own together, and Kansas gives that pattern constitutional weight: an occupied homestead cannot be alienated without the joint consent of husband and wife, so a homestead deed signed by both spouses as grantors carries its own consent on its face. The same two-signature architecture serves co-owners who are not married to each other, two heirs conveying inherited land in one instrument, and joint tenants or tenants in common selling the whole parcel together. Each grantor block includes a marital status line, because K.S.A. 59-505 separately protects a spouse against lifetime transfers of other real estate made without written consent, and title examiners read marital status from the face of the record. The form recites exactly two grantors; a conveyance by a sole owner, or by three or more co-owners, presents a different signature pattern.

A certificate for each signer

Kansas notarial certificates follow the short forms adopted by K.A.R. 7-43-17, and the certificates on this deed carry the regulation's operative sentence: this record was acknowledged before me on a stated date by a named person. The form provides a separate certificate for each grantor, so the two signers may acknowledge on different dates, before different notarial officers, or in different states, with each certificate reflecting the venue where that grantor actually appeared. Kansas deed statutes call for no witnesses; under K.S.A. 58-2205, a deed executed, acknowledged, and recorded passes title without any other act or ceremony. Printed name lines under each signature answer K.S.A. 28-115(c), which reads the typed or printed name of every signer and notary into the recording fee statute.

Into the record at the register of deeds

Kansas records deeds county by county at the register of deeds, and intake turns on two companions: the statutory fee schedule of K.S.A. 28-115, published by counties at $21 for the first page and $17 for each page after it, and the real estate sales validation questionnaire of K.S.A. 79-1437c, which accompanies the deed unless a statutory exemption is stated on the document itself. The deed carries the exemption sentence with its number blank, a tax statement section for the grantee address that K.S.A. 58-2221 requires, and a first page that reserves a full three inches for the recording stamp. Kansas imposes no transfer tax on deeds.
